The School of Art within the College of Visual and Performing Arts seeks a Part-Time Instructor to teach ARI 372 Etching & Relief, a three credit hour course, during the Fall semester, 2026.

Introductory etching and relief techniques, including: single- and multi-color woodcut, hard ground line etching, aquatint, scraping and burnishing, soft ground, drypoint, multi-color printing, editioning. Includes a history and contemporary uses of etching and relief printmaking.
